Michael Robinson, interim director of Humility of Mary Home Health Services, recently received the Susan Smith Makos Spirit Award from Catholic Health Partners. The award recognizes management leaders who exemplify serving and advocating for patients in their communities. Under Robinson’s leadership, more than $4 million in prescriptions were processed through Humility of Mary Health Partner’s Prescription Assistance Program. He was also instrumental in bringing Catholic Health Partner’s Resource Mothers Program to HMHP and helped the hospital system’s diabetes education program achieve Gold Standard Recognition from the American Diabetes Association.

Mark Cole, a multiple line agent for American National Insurance Company, has been named a financial services specialist by The American College and the National Association of Insurance and Financial Advisors. The professional designation is given to individuals who meet or exceed qualification standards. In addition to completing five courses, candidates for this designation must also complete an ethics course and be a member in good standing with the National Association of Insurance and Financial Advisors.

Strollo Architects recently received two design awards from regional chapters of the American Institute of Architects. For its work on St. Elizabeth Boardman Health Center, the firm received the association’s Eastern Ohio Chapter’s 2010 Honor Award, the organization’s highest recognition. The firm’s work on Youngstown State University’s new Williamson College of Business Administration received a Honorable Mention Award for interior design from the Ohio-Kentucky chapter of the American Institute of Architects/International Interior Design Association.

Cogun Inc., a church design and construction company based in North Lima, recently received two Solomon Awards from Church Production and Worship Facilities magazines. The awards recognize church teams, individuals and industry partners for excellence in church facilities, design, management and audio visual production. Cogun was awarded for two projects, the Crowfield Baptist Church in Goose Creek, S.C. and Grace Fellowship Church in Johnson City, Tenn.
